概括
自动驾驶汽车 (AV) 必须更好地了解人类行为,以便在复杂的城市环境中安全导航. 制定"道路使用者理论"对于自动驾驶汽车来说至关重要,它可以预测并对人类驾驶员,行人和骑自行车者作出反应.

Visual System
581
Light enters the eye through the cornea, a transparent, dome-shaped surface covering the surface of the eyeball that helps to direct and focus incoming light. This light is then channeled toward the pupil, an adjustable opening whose size is controlled by the iris. The iris, a pigmented muscle, regulates the amount of light entering the eye by contracting or dilating the pupil, thereby ensuring optimal light levels for clear vision.
